PMSI Announces New, Clinically Based Home Healthcare Solution

November 11, 2010 - WorkCompWire

Innovative, Clinically Based Approach Delivers Significant Benefits

Tampa, Florida (November 11, 2010) – PMSI, one of the nation’s largest providers of specialty products and services for the workers’ compensation market, announced today the launch of its enhanced home health care program. By integrating established clinical guidelines, a broad network of providers and insightful reporting of outcomes, the program provides access to high quality home health services while controlling costs for clients across the claims management life cycle.

“Our new home health care program takes a fresh approach to the management and delivery of this very challenging service line and ensures appropriate utilization for our clients,” said Eileen Auen, chairman and CEO of PMSI. “Our approach is an illustration of how PMSI is delivering quantifiable results through clinically based programs that control costs and expedite return-to-work.”

PMSI’s research shows that nearly 44 percent of home health transactions will also require additional services in areas such as durable medical equipment (DME), rehabilitation devices, and medical supplies. PMSI’s new approach to home health care is based on a proprietary rules engine that includes industry-specific data and established clinical guidelines. By applying clinical oversight and evaluating the progression of care, the program enables early detection of inappropriate utilization of both home health and associated cost areas. Customers are provided with actionable information and specific recommendations that offer opportunities to modify treatment plans in ways that improve outcomes and lower costs. Through this approach, PMSI has identified opportunities to deliver 12 to 18 percent cost savings on home health care and related services.

“PMSI is focused on the delivery of scientific, evidence-based care in conjunction with clinical expertise. This combination delivers higher quality and predictable costs,” commented Jay Krueger, PMSI’s Chief Strategy Officer. “Given PMSI’s broad service offering, we can clinically coordinate all the needs arising during home health service and assure that the right care is delivered at the right time with the right intensity.”
